170. Deputy Seán Kyne asked the Minister for Finance if there are any proposed changes to section 481 of the Taxes Consolidation Act 1997 regarding tax relief for film making; if consideration is being given to extending the tax relief available to the creative arts industries such as animation and game production in view of the introduction of such a relief in the UK;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[20308/14]
